Compare all specifications:
1978 Lancia A 112 | 2010 Chrysler Town & Country | |
Make | Lancia | Chrysler |
Model | A 112 | Town & Country |
Year Released | 1978 | 2010 |
Body Type | Hatchback | Minivan |
Engine Size | 903 cc | 4000 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 4 cylinders | 6 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| V |
Horse Power | 0 HP | 251 HP |
Fuel Type | Gasoline | Gasoline |
Drive Type | Front | Front |
Transmission Type | Manual | Automatic |
Number of Doors | 3 doors | 5 doors |
Vehicle Weight | 655 kg | 2096 kg |
Vehicle Length | 3230 mm | 5144 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1490 mm | 1953 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1370 mm | 1814 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2040 mm | 3078 mm |
